Warehouse Operative Job Description
Location: Fareham, Hampshire, United Kingdom
Salary: Competitive
Job Type: Full-time, Permanent
Lathams Limited is seeking a Warehouse Operative to join our team in Fareham, Hampshire, United Kingdom. As a Warehouse Operative, you will be responsible for performing a variety of warehouse duties, including receiving and processing incoming stock, picking and filling orders, packing and shipping orders, and managing and organizing inventory. You will also be responsible for maintaining a clean and organized warehouse environment and ensuring that all health and safety policies and procedures are followed.
Will be working in a 5/6 man team.
On two weeks early shift 5am-2pm, then two weeks late shift 1.30pm – 10.30pm.
Mon-Fri excluding bank holidays and Christmas shutdown.
